The first step in filing an asbestos lawsuit is to meet with a mesothelioma attorney to get an evaluation of your case for free. Your lawyer will assist you in determining which companies are responsible for your case and which type of claim is best. Asbestos exposure can occur in a variety of ways and it could be difficult for people to remember exactly when they were exposed or at what locations. However, mesothelioma lawyers have access to databases that contain thousands of companies, products, and job places where asbestos exposure has occurred.

Asbestos lawyers are also able to investigate the details of a case and locate evidence that supports your assertions. For instance, you could have medical records that confirm your mesothelioma diagnosis or a death certificate that lists "mesothelioma" as the cause of the loved one's death. Asbestos lawyers are well-versed in the process of ordering these documents and know the questions to ask to get the most info from them.

A mesothelioma attorney who is knowledgeable will also know the state laws that affect the how you make your claim. In New York, for example you must bring your case within the state if the firm that exposed you to asbestos is located in that. Lawyers from national firms have experience in filing claims in different states and are familiar with the laws in each state.

Mesothelioma is a potentially fatal and painful illness, affects the linings of the lungs. It is caused by exposure to asbestos which was used in a variety of residential and commercial construction products for more than 30 years. Exposure to asbestos can occur in a variety of locations such as at work, at school, or at home.

A person diagnosed mesothelioma is able to bring a lawsuit for personal injury against the company that exposed them to asbestos. They may also file a lawsuit for the compensation of loved ones who have passed away from mesothelioma, asbestos-related illnesses.

Asbestos sufferers can claim financial compensation for expenses like lost wages, medical bills and the cost of treatment. Asbestos lawyers can assist their clients recover damages through mesothelioma lawsuits or trust fund claims against the companies that are responsible for their asbestos exposure. They can also assist their clients in filing a wrongful death lawsuit on behalf of a loved one who has died from mesothelioma.

An attorney for mesothelioma can determine if a patient has a valid claim and help the patient file a lawsuit, VA claim or trust fund. Each mesothelioma claim is unique and based on a number of factors, such as the patient's exposure to asbestos, their age when diagnosed, and the amount of money they've lost due the disease. Compensation could include the cost of medical treatment in the past and the future as well as lost wages, the loss of a loved one, legal fees, punitive damages and pain and suffering.
